Output 95c697e31675978ac7944e8b381c861bb149030ff04d5aae9e80f3a2f6559604:0

value
149256330
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de02079f34deb7a46a91cc05b4d1891ada880c53 OP_EQUALVERIFY OP_CHECKSIG
address
1MEsScp8GzPF9eSk5RFzcCWRkbyEnGHJ2K
transaction
95c697e31675978ac7944e8b381c861bb149030ff04d5aae9e80f3a2f6559604
spent
true